How BIMA Deductions Work — The Full Picture 1 Automatic — So You're Always Covered BIMA deducts automatically on the same date each month — so you never accidentally miss a payment and find yourself unprotected when you need care. No action needed from you. 2 SMS Confirmation Every Time Every time BIMA deducts, you receive an SMS with your BIMA ID and the amount. This is your proof of active coverage. Check your message history — it's there. 3 Coverage Starts Immediately The moment your premium is paid, your family is covered for the full month. Doctor calls, medicine delivery, hospital cash — all available, no extra steps. 📅 When exactly can you use each benefit? Some benefits are available almost immediately. Others apply throughout each monthly cycle. Here's a clear breakdown. FROM Next Day after payment 📞 Doctor consultations \(Telemedicine\) Available from the next day after payment. Call a qualified doctor by dialling **\*550\#** — day or night, any day of the week. For you, your child, or any registered family member. ✅ Available from next day Other benefits — active throughout each month you're subscribed 💊 Medicine delivery After a teleconsultation with your BIMA doctor, your prescribed medicines are delivered to your door. 📅 Each Active Month 🏥 Hospital cash If you are admitted to hospital, BIMA pays you daily cash for each day admitted — for each active month. 📅 Each active month ❤️ Life cover In the event of accidental death, your family receives a lump sum. This protection is active as long as your monthly payment is maintained. 📅 Each active month 💡 **What this means for you right now:** Even if you just paid your premium and you're upset about the deduction — you can call a doctor from tomorrow. Cancellation Request Cancel Your BIMA Insurance Fill in your details and a BIMA associate will contact you to confirm your cancellation within 24–48 hours. What happens when you cancel Your coverage remains active until the end of your current billing period. No further deductions will be made after cancellation is confirmed. Doctor consultations and medicine delivery will no longer be accessible. Hospital cash and life cover benefits will no longer apply. Previous premiums paid are not refunded as they covered the months your protection was active. Can't afford it right now?
